Tomato Jos in Nigeria is the winner of the 2024 SAVE FOOD project competition

17/01/2025

Every year, the SAVE FOOD project competition honours exemplary projects. This year, the award and the funding amount of 10,000 euros are going to Nigeria, where a combination of modern technology, transport packaging, education programmes and direct market access has significantly reduced post-harvest losses.

New SAVE FOOD Study on Food Loss in India

23/05/2016

FAO examines the reasons and mechanisms of food loss in chickpeas, mangos, milk and rice The United Nations Food and Agriculture Organisation (FAO) is carrying out extensive studies on the topic of food losses in various districts of India between May and July 2016. This was made possible by the membership fees of the SAVE FOOD Initiative.
